How to fill out confidentiality policy 8 10

How to fill out confidentiality policy 8 10:
01
Start by reading through the entire policy document to familiarize yourself with its contents and requirements.
02
Gather all the necessary information and documentation that is required to fill out the policy. This may include employee information, company policies and procedures, and any relevant legal or regulatory requirements.
03
Begin by filling out the header section of the policy, which typically includes the title, date, and any reference numbers or identifiers.
04
Proceed to the introduction section, where you can provide an overview of the policy and its purpose. This section may also include any definitions or terminology that will be used throughout the document.
05
Move on to the scope section, which defines the boundaries and applicability of the policy. Specify who or what the policy applies to, such as employees, contractors, or specific departments within the organization.
06
Include a section on responsibilities and obligations, outlining the duties and expectations of all parties involved in maintaining confidentiality. This may include guidelines for handling sensitive information, reporting breaches, and implementing security measures.
07
Detail the procedures and processes for ensuring confidentiality. This may involve outlining steps for secure storage, data encryption, access controls, and employee training.
08
Consider including a section on consequences and disciplinary actions for non-compliance with the policy. This can help enforce the importance of confidentiality and serve as a deterrent against potential breaches.
09
Review the policy for completeness, accuracy, and clarity. Ensure that all necessary sections have been included and that the language used is easily understandable by the target audience.
10
Share the completed policy with relevant stakeholders, such as employees, managers, and legal or compliance departments, to gather feedback and address any concerns before finalizing the document.
